The Mauritius Leaks were the report of a datajournalistic investigation by the International Consortium of Investigative Journalists (ICIJ) in 2019 about how the former British colony Mauritius has transformed itself into a thriving financial centre and tax haven.[1][2][3]
A whistleblower leaked documents from a law firm in Mauritius to the investigative journalists, providing insight in how multinational companies avoid paying taxes when they do business in Africa, the Middle East, and Asia.
